Hi Tim,

 

Please see www.draytek.co.uk <http://www.draytek.co.uk/>  for details.
Essencially you will need to download the router tools (includes
firmware update tool), and will need to download the firmware image -
you should use the .all file and send it to the router.

          Hi,
        
          I think someone may have used this before.  On the router
there is a reset button which will need pushing by a paper clip.  Please
reset the router and report back on the IP address returned through
ipconfig.  If the IP address has changed from the default then I think
the password may have been changed also.  I am trying to get a
definitive answer as to the specs on this model as I haven't used one,
but that IP address doesn't look standard to me.

              Hi,
        
              By default the router is on the following:
        
              Ip: 192.168.1.1
              user: admin
              Password: [blank]
